Onboarding: Hexforge migration. The Brindlewatt build moved to the hermetic toolchain last quarter. No system compilers, no network during builds — all deps are pinned in the lockfile. If a target fails with a missing tool, add it to the toolchain manifest; never shell out. Legacy non-hermetic targets live under //attic and are frozen. Reproducibility checks run nightly. To sign the sealed toolchain archive, you'll need the recovery passphrase below.

vault phrase of taweg-kafof = oliax-zorael

## Visitor Handling — Front Desk

All visitors to Brasker Tower sign in at the front desk and receive a day pass from the tray. Team assistants escort their own visitors at all times; do not leave guests unattended in the lift lobby. Day passes are returned at departure and logged. If the pass printer is out of stock, refills are in the cabinet behind reception, which opens with the code below.

door code, kawip-bagap: bdg-HQEWH-4

## Step 3: Point Nightwheel at the new cluster

Welcome aboard! Nightwheel is the little scheduler that kicks off our nightly backfills for the Marlowe warehouse. After the old Queensferry cluster retires next month, every job definition needs the updated coordinator settings — otherwise your backfills will just sit in the queue forever (ask anyone on the Otterby team how fun that is). Paste the following block into your local overrides before restarting the worker:

config for bahop-fajep:
DRUATH_PIN=4501
DRUATH_TENANT=briwyn
DRUATH_METRICS_HOST=metrics.druath.brasksoft.test
DRUATH_SEAL=seal_7d2e069d
DRUATH_STANDBY_TEAM=olieth

TICKET FS-2291 — Fieldmapper offline mode drops queued surveys

Severity: High. When a Fieldmapper device stays offline past 6 hours, queued survey entries silently vanish on reconnect instead of syncing. Repro: airplane mode, submit 3 surveys, wait, reconnect. Two of three lost. Suspect the queue compaction job purging unsynced rows. Affects v4.8 only; v4.7 devices fine. On-call: hold the 4.8 rollout, advise field teams to sync before end of shift. The offending build's trace token follows below.

pipeline stamp: htk9_ce63042d9